Chief Executive John Lee announced Hong Kong's inaugural five-year plan on Sunday, aiming to enhance the lives of city residents through long-term development strategies. In a video posted on his social media, Lee revealed that authorities had solicited public input on the blueprint and the latest Policy Address over the past two months.

He explained that releasing the two documents on the same day helps clarify their interconnectedness. The five-year plan seeks to continuously elevate people's livelihoods via long-term strategies, while the Policy Address outlines yearly measures to improve housing, livelihoods, healthcare, and other vital sectors. Lee expressed gratitude to the public for their valuable suggestions during the consultation period, stating that the government will review and incorporate these views into the documents to foster economic growth, bolster livelihoods, and create new opportunities for Hong Kong.

He emphasized that the SAR government remains committed to addressing people's needs and propelling the city forward.
